我的编程启蒙故事
我从小就对计算机和数字感兴趣,这可能和我父母都是从事信息技术行业有关。在我还不到十岁时,他们就开始教我编程的基础知识。
编程的基础知识
我学习的第一个编程语言是Scratch。它是一种由麻省理工学院开发的图形化编程语言,专门为年轻人设计。Scratch易于学习并提供了一个友好的编程环境,它让我很快地理解了编程的基本概念以及程序的逻辑。
我的第一个项目是编写一个简单的动画程序。通过拖拽图形模块并组合它们,我成功地创建了一个跳舞的机器人。看到我的机器人动起来,我感觉到非常的兴奋和满足。
感觉到编程的乐趣
Scratch不仅仅是一种编程工具,它还提供了一个社区,让程序员们可以互相交流和合作。我开始分享我的项目和我的想法,和其他年轻的程序员建立了联系。
通过创作和分享项目,我越来越感受到编程的乐趣,以及它对我的创造力、逻辑思维和解决问题的能力的影响。
迈向更复杂的编程语言
随着我的兴趣和技能的不断提升,我开始探索更全面的编程语言,例如Python和Java。这些语言更加具有挑战性,但也更广泛地应用于现实生活中的问题解决。
我开始从编写简单的算法程序到自动化脚本编写,到编写现实世界的应用程序。我做了一个交互式的数学学习平台,帮助高中生们解决复杂的数学问题。我还开发了一个在线游戏,让人们可以一起玩并分享他们的游戏体验。
编程与未来
编程不仅是一个有趣的爱好,也是制造未来和解决问题的神奇工具。通过编程,我学到了很多东西,我已经开始意识到,在未来的工作生涯中,编程技能将会是非常必要的。我希望能继续学习和发展我的编程技能,成为一个有用的软件工程师。
虽然我的编程生涯还很短,但是我相信编程已经成为我的一部分,并将引导我的未来。